在移动应用开发领域,选择合适的框架和组件库是决定项目成功的关键因素之一。Vue3作为当下最流行的前端框架之一,以其简洁的语法、高效的性能和丰富的生态系统,为移动端开发者提供了强大的支持。本文将为您介绍Vue3的一些精选框架组件库,帮助您轻松打造高效的应用。
Vue3简介
Vue3是Vue.js的下一代主要版本,它带来了许多改进,包括更快的性能、更好的类型支持和更灵活的配置选项。Vue3的推出,标志着Vue.js进入了全新的发展阶段,为开发者提供了更多可能。
精选框架组件库
1. Vant
Vant是一款基于Vue 2和Vue 3的移动端组件库,适用于构建轻量、高效的移动端应用。Vant提供了丰富的组件,包括布局、图标、表格、开关、加载、动作面板等,可以满足大多数移动端应用的需求。
- 布局组件:提供栅格、单元格等布局组件,方便快速搭建应用界面。
- 图标组件:包含多种图标,支持自定义图标样式。
- 表格组件:提供列表、表格等组件,方便展示数据。
2. Element UI
Element UI是一款基于Vue 2和Vue 3的桌面端组件库,但也适用于移动端开发。它提供了丰富的组件,包括布局、表格、表单、按钮、时间选择器等,适合构建复杂的应用。
- 布局组件:提供栅格、布局容器等组件,方便快速搭建界面。
- 表格组件:提供表格、树形表格等组件,用于展示和操作数据。
- 表单组件:提供输入框、选择器、开关等组件,用于收集用户输入。
3. Quasar Framework
Quasar是一个基于Vue的全面框架,适用于构建跨平台的应用,包括移动端、桌面端和Web端。Quasar提供了丰富的组件和工具,可以帮助开发者快速构建高性能的应用。
- 移动端组件:提供布局、导航、表单、媒体查询等组件。
- 桌面端组件:提供桌面端特有组件,如桌面托盘、桌面系统菜单等。
- Web端组件:提供Web端特有组件,如对话框、模态框等。
4. Vue Native
Vue Native是一个开源框架,允许开发者使用Vue.js语法编写移动端应用。它通过将Vue组件转换为原生组件,实现了跨平台开发。Vue Native提供了丰富的组件,包括布局、导航、表单、媒体查询等。
- 布局组件:提供栅格、布局容器等组件,方便快速搭建界面。
- 导航组件:提供导航栏、底部导航等组件,方便构建导航结构。
- 表单组件:提供输入框、选择器、开关等组件,用于收集用户输入。
高效应用打造技巧
- 组件复用:合理复用组件,减少重复代码,提高开发效率。
- 路由管理:使用Vue Router进行路由管理,优化应用结构。
- 状态管理:使用Vuex进行状态管理,确保应用数据的一致性。
- 性能优化:关注性能优化,如懒加载、代码分割等,提升应用速度。
通过以上介绍的Vue3框架组件库和开发技巧,相信您已经对如何打造高效移动端应用有了更深入的了解。希望这些内容能对您的开发工作有所帮助。
